Can I be a cashier if I have social anxiety?

Can I be a cashier if I have social anxiety?

Cashier. A position as a cashier involves dealing with the public, handling money, making change, and sometimes working under pressure. Although on a quiet day this job may not present too many social challenges, on a busy day it will be filled with opportunities to challenge your social anxiety.

What is the best job for someone with social anxiety?

Tutor. Tutoring is arguably the best starter job for someone with social anxiety because it allows you to practice social interaction with one or two people at a time.

Can work cause social anxiety?

New social or work demands. Social anxiety disorder symptoms typically start in the teenage years, but meeting new people, giving a speech in public or making an important work presentation may trigger symptoms for the first time.

What are some triggers for social anxiety?

Situations that trigger social anxiety include:

  • Dating.
  • Eating in view of other people.
  • Entering a room in which people are already seated.
  • Having to interact with strangers or unfamiliar people.
  • Having to return store items.
  • Initiating conversations.
  • Making eye contact.
  • Parties or social gatherings.

What is extreme social anxiety?

Social anxiety disorder, sometimes referred to as social phobia, is a type of anxiety disorder that causes extreme fear in social settings. People with this disorder have trouble talking to people, meeting new people, and attending social gatherings. They fear being judged or scrutinized by others.
